POLL: Describe your IBS Symptoms

Hello everyone,

I think this exercise will help us in understanding our condition better.

1. Type of IBS, D, C or Both? I'm mainly D but I also get C.
2. How many times do you go to the bathroom a day? From 2 to 4 to None.
3. How often do you get an attack? I have IBS almost everyday of my life
3. What other symptoms do you have? Nauseas, stomach cramps, belching, gas, and these have caused anxiety and some depression.
4. When did you first got IBS, what was the trigger? I got it 1 year ago. Personal problems were the trigger.
5. What foods can't you tolerate? Milk, TVP (soy) but tofu is ok, oils, Indian food, spicy food.
6. What are you currently taking for IBS? Citrucel, calcium, acidophilus, and soon Calm Colon from Samra.
7. Were you officially diagnosed? What test did your doctor run? Yes, Flex sigmoid, blood tests, stools test, breath test.
8. Does your IBS depress you? YES!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!

1. Type of IBS, D, C or Both?
Mostly D, can be progressive during the day from nasty C to violent D.
2. How many times do you go to the bathroom a day?
Anywhere from every 3 days to 8 times a day
3. How often do you get an attack?
At least 3 times aweek
4. What other symptoms do you have?
general malaise, headaches, major lower back pain, depression, anxiety, reflux/heartburn, bloating, gas, cramps, fatigue...
5. When did you first got IBS, what was the trigger?
Started 13 years ago in high school. I think it started because of contaminated town water, then continued for a multitude of personal reasons (although at 14, I was unaware of their long term impact!).
6. What foods can't you tolerate?
Pineapple, coconut, anything corn related, onions, raw veggies, have cut all meat out of my diet, greasy foods; somedays, I think if I just look at any food the wrong way, it will come attack me later...
7. What are you currently taking for IBS?
A lot of sick days ...Levsin SL, on desipramine for depression which helps the D
8. Were you officially diagnosed? What test did your doctor run?
Yes, had flex sig (which showed some tissue with "Crohn's tendancy"), blood tests, 2 upper GI w/ sm. bowel follows, colonoscopy, was hospitalized once and the a**holes actually tested me for laxative abuse b/c of the constant D
8. Does your IBS depress you?
Yes, the isolation that it brings can be unbearable. Thank God for an amazing husband and family. Otherwise I would not be here.

1. Type of IBS, D, C or Both?
I am mainly C, but alternate with D. The pain with the D is the worst!

2. How many times do you go to the bathroom a day?
For the first time in my life, I go 1 or 2x when I wake up and then I'm done. This has only been since I started the fiber supplements. Before that, I has pebbles (and gas ) all day for several days, then pain, then D.

3. How often do you get an attack?
I have improved tremendously since I started Heather's diet. I used to have symptoms everyday, and then actual attacks every two weeks or so. They would last for 2 or 3 weeks. It sucked!

3. What other symptoms do you have?
Again, symptoms have all but disappeared, but it used to be nausea, pain, pressure, bloating, urgency. Now it's just urgency and some gas.

4. When did you first got IBS, what was the trigger?
I have always been constipated, and have always been sensitive to greasy foods, but the trouble really started 2 years ago after a bad reaction to buffet food in Las Vegas (while on a romantic 10th anniversary trip- so much for the romance, huh?!?!)

5. What foods can't you tolerate?
fatty foods, artificial sweeteners (diet soda gives me the runs!), gassy veggies, soy milk

6. What are you currently taking for IBS?
Citrucel in the am, benefiber in the pm (for some reason, citrucel agrees with me in the morning but makes me gassy/bloated at night), acidophilus, Prozac. The fiber supps have been the number 1 most effective tool so far.

7. Were you officially diagnosed? What test did your doctor run?
I've had a CT done, also had my gall bladder checked. My doc told me I have IBS after asking tons of questions and
reviewing the test resuls.

8. Does your IBS depress you?
Yes! BUT IT'S GETTING BETTER, thanks to fiber supps, eating (mainly) safe foods, and the Prozac. I used to be practically housebound, but now I can leave with very little worry or anxiety. My life has improved SO MUCH since I started Heather's diet. I still worry some about "unknown" foods and gas problems (when I get nervous I get gas!)
